KEY FACTORS

Factors that Affect Erie Car Shipping Costs

Distance

Shipping costs from Erie are primarily determined by the distance to your destination, with longer routes naturally requiring more fuel, time, and carrier resources. Erie's location in northwestern Pennsylvania means shipping to nearby cities like Cleveland or Pittsburgh will be significantly cheaper than cross-country routes to California or Florida. Our AI-verified pricing engine accounts for exact mileage and current fuel costs to give you transparent, assignment-ready quotes that carriers actually accept.

Season

Winter shipping to and from Erie typically costs 10-20% more due to harsh Lake Erie weather, snow accumulation, and reduced carrier availability during December through February. Spring and fall offer moderate pricing with predictable conditions, while summer sees steady demand without extreme weather premiums. Our 95% successful carrier securement rate means we can often lock in competitive rates year-round, even during Erie's challenging winter season.

Route

Erie's primary access routes via Interstate 90 and Route 20 connect you to major shipping corridors, but winter weather and road conditions on these highways can affect pricing and timing. Carriers shipping to or from Erie often factor in potential delays during snow season (November-March) when planning routes, which may increase costs during peak winter months. Direct access to these major interstates generally keeps Erie competitive for pricing compared to more remote Pennsylvania locations.

Vehicle Type

Compact sedans and standard vehicles are the most economical to ship from Erie, while oversized trucks, SUVs, and luxury vehicles require specialized carriers and cost more due to weight and equipment needs. Classic and military vehicles often need enclosed transport, which increases costs but protects your investment—something we specialize in across our platform. Dealerships shipping multiple vehicles from Erie benefit from our volume expertise and ability to consolidate shipments for better rates.

Moving Insights

Things to Know About Moving to/from Erie

Professional auto transport service for Erie moves

When planning auto transport to or from Erie, PA, understanding Pennsylvania's vehicle registration process is essential. The state requires new residents to register vehicles within 20 days of establishing residency, with registration handled through PennDOT [DMV]. Erie drivers should know that Pennsylvania mandates emissions testing for most vehicles, with testing facilities located throughout the city [DMV]. Before shipping your car to Erie, ensure it meets state requirements for window tinting (no darker than 70% light transmittance on front windows) and verify frame height regulations if you've modified your vehicle [DMV].



Erie-specific considerations include strict downtown parking regulations and weather-related challenges that impact vehicle condition. The city experiences heavy snow and ice during winter months, making winter tires or all-season tires essential for safety [City Website]. When arranging car shipping to Erie, gather proper documentation including your title and proof of residency. Pennsylvania's insurance requirements mandate minimum bodily injury and property damage coverage, with rates varying based on driving history and vehicle type [DMV]. Consider comprehensive and collision coverage given Erie's winter weather patterns. Understanding these regulations before your vehicle arrives ensures a smooth transition and helps you avoid costly compliance issues.

When shipping from or to Erie, PA, you'll want to remove any toll passes (particularly for Pennsylvania Turnpike access), secure a vehicle key for your carrier, and remove fragile interior and exterior accessories that could shift during transit on I-90. Make sure your fuel tank is no more than a quarter full to reduce weight, and document your vehicle's condition before pickup so you're prepared for our digital inspection process.

Yes, your vehicle is fully insured when shipping to or from Erie, PA. All carriers on our network are FMCSA-licensed and required to carry a minimum of $1,000,000 in liability insurance and $100,000 in cargo insurance. We verify that each carrier's insurance policy is valid and in good standing throughout your shipment, so your vehicle is protected every mile of the way.

A designated (adult) must be present at pickup and delivery. This designated person plays an important role in the shipping process including documenting the state of the vehicle and signing the Bill of Lading, which acts as a receipt of the vehicle's condition.

Enclosed transport costs at least 50% more than open trailers, but provides superior protection—especially important for Erie's variable weather conditions and winter road salt exposure. We recommend enclosed transport for high-value vehicles like classics, luxury cars, or custom builds that need protection from debris and the elements during transit. Open transport is a reliable, cost-effective option for standard vehicles making the journey to or from Erie. All Sakaem Logistics carriers are fully insured regardless of transport type, so you have peace of mind either way.

DID YOU KNOW?

Fun Facts About Erie

Discover interesting insights about the state you're shipping to or from

Erie, PA sits on the shores of Lake Erie, making it a unique destination for anyone shipping a car to or from northwestern Pennsylvania. This lakeside city blends rich history, natural beauty, and modern transportation infrastructure. Whether you're relocating to Erie or moving away, here are some fascinating facts about this special corner of Pennsylvania.

  • Gateway to the Great Lakes: Erie is Pennsylvania's only port city, offering direct access to Lake Erie and the Great Lakes shipping corridor. The Erie International Airport (EIB) and the Port of Erie make this city a vital transportation hub for vehicles and cargo alike.
  • Presque Isle State Park: This 3,200-acre peninsula is a natural wonder featuring sandy beaches, hiking trails, and stunning lake views. It's one of Pennsylvania's most visited state parks and a must-see for anyone relocating to the area.
  • Historic Naval Significance: Erie played a crucial role in the War of 1812, earning the nickname "Gem City." Commodore Perry's fleet was built here, and you can visit the Perry Monument downtown.
  • Moderate Lake-Effect Climate: Erie experiences significant lake-effect snow during winter months, so vehicle owners should prepare accordingly. Spring and fall offer pleasant weather perfect for scenic drives along the waterfront.
  • Growing Tech and Manufacturing Hub: Beyond its maritime heritage, Erie has diversified into advanced manufacturing and technology sectors, attracting new residents and businesses to the region.

Car Shipping 101

How Auto Transport Works

Car shipping in Erie, PA doesn't have to be complicated. Whether you're moving to California, Florida, Texas, or anywhere else, understanding the auto transport process helps you make informed decisions. Here's a 101 guide to how car shipping works from start to finish.

The car shipping process involves two key players: brokers and carriers. A broker like Sakaem Logistics connects you with actual carriers who transport your vehicle. Carriers are the companies that own and operate the trucks. This distinction matters because brokers handle the logistics and customer service, while carriers focus on safe delivery. Working with a reputable broker ensures you're matched with licensed, insured carriers who have solid reviews and track records.

Here's how the process works step-by-step: First, call a broker to get a quote for your auto transport needs. The broker will ask about your vehicle type, pickup location in Erie, and destination. Next, the broker finds a carrier that fits your timeline and vehicle requirements. Once matched, the carrier schedules a pickup and inspects your car. Before pickup day, clear out all personal items from your vehicle—carriers only transport the car itself. Your vehicle must be able to roll onto the transport truck, and it should have about a quarter tank of gas for the journey. For high-end or classic cars, request an enclosed trailer for extra protection during transport. The carrier then picks up your vehicle and transports it to your destination. Finally, upon delivery, you'll pay the broker or carrier according to your agreement. Throughout this journey, your dedicated point of contact keeps you informed every step of the way.
